Output 3f96361ebd154770125e7c98c68a9bef9ee0360339ae8494b5274c660102037c:7

value
2762755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2f1f0cbbc98c4f8ae99673eedb893fe23f7db82 OP_EQUAL
address
3J1C31z31LxEVVPSurRa4TdvzTfsp1sEUy
transaction
3f96361ebd154770125e7c98c68a9bef9ee0360339ae8494b5274c660102037c
confirmations
475291
spent
true